Taylor Swift has taken over the complete Prime 10 of the Billboard Scorching 100 chart, changing into the first-ever artist to so do. All 10 songs atop this week’s Scorching 100 come from Swift’s album Midnights, which was launched on Oct. 21. With the information, Swift surpasses Drake’s feat final yr, when he captured 9 of the Prime 10 spots on the Scorching 100 chart.

“Anti-Hero” took the No. 1 spot, changing “Unholy” by Sam Smith and Kim Petras — each of whom made their very own mark on historical past with their No. 1 spot final week.

The album continues to interrupt a string of information, together with being the most-streamed album in sooner or later on each Spotify and Apple Music and logging the third-biggest streaming week ever for an album. Swift’s album Crimson (Taylor’s Model) beforehand held the mantle for Swift’s largest streaming week in 2021.

Midnights additionally earned Swift her eleventh No. 1 album on the Billboard 200 chart, recording the largest week for any album in 7 years (since Adele’s 25). Swift has tied Barbara Streisand for probably the most No. 1 albums launched by a feminine artist, based on Billboard.

Swift centered Midnights on the traditional trope of the midnight confession, utilizing a conversational singing fashion to inform tales for after-hours impressed by self-loathing, fantasizing about revenge and questioning what might need been.

Together with releasing new music, Swift has been re-recording her traditional albums after her former label, Huge Machine, bought her catalog for a reported $300 million to private-equity group Ithaca Holdings. She has launched re-recordings of her albums Fearless and Crimson.
